Transaction a63c2b01ae504a12644db5fd3c615e785b1652817f40be24e175f949c2fcee9a

1 Input
2 Outputs
  • a63c2b01ae504a12644db5fd3c615e785b1652817f40be24e175f949c2fcee9a:0
  • value  80600
    address  31pLH79ytepfheRKMheyiteiBP1iJWf4UK
  • a63c2b01ae504a12644db5fd3c615e785b1652817f40be24e175f949c2fcee9a:1
  • value  423752676
    address  16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y